Published Oct 11, 2023 ⦁ 11 min read

Best Online Form Makers for Developing Smart Surveys

Introduction: Why Online Form Builders Are Essential for Developers

Online form builders allow developers to easily create forms for data collection without coding. Forms are critical for developers to capture user information, conduct surveys, implement quizzes, and more. With powerful form builders, you can add logic and conditional branching to create smart surveys that adapt based on user responses. Choosing the right online form builder can save developers significant time compared to building from scratch. This article reviews the top online form builders for developers to find the ideal platforms for their needs.

Forms are an indispensable tool for developers. They allow for easy data collection from users without having to hard code the form layouts and logic. Form builders empower developers to quickly build quizzes, user profiles, contact forms, surveys, and more to support their projects. Especially useful are advanced form builders that enable conditional logic and branching. This allows the survey or quiz experience to adapt based on the user's responses, creating a dynamic and personalized flow. The time savings from using a form builder rather than hand coding can be immense. This makes it critical for developers to select the right form builder for their specific needs and use cases. This review covers key factors to evaluate and top form builder options to consider.

Key Features to Look for in Form Builders

When evaluating form builders, there are several key features developers should look for:

Drag-and-Drop Form Editors

Look for intuitive form builders with drag-and-drop interfaces to arrange fields. Editors with drag-and-drop make it fast and easy to construct forms without coding. Prioritize builders that allow drag-and-drop on both desktop and mobile for flexibility. Form editors with drag-and-drop reduce development time vs hard-coding forms. Drag-and-drop placement of fields provides visual form design without needing to write code.

The form builder's interface is critical, as you want something intuitive that allows dragging and dropping form fields into place. This type of visual editor enables rapid design without hard coding the HTML and layout. It provides flexibility to rearrange and perfect the form flow. You can quickly build forms on both desktop and mobile. For developers, an elegant drag-and-drop form editor can shave hours off development time compared to hand coding forms and tweaking CSS. It also allows non-technical colleagues to help construct forms. Overall, drag-and-drop form editors are a huge time saver.

Integrations

Key integrations connect forms directly to databases, email services, payment systems, etc. Integrations eliminate manual data transfer and streamline form use. Priority integrations include MySQL, Salesforce, Mailchimp, Stripe, PayPal, etc. Native integrations avoid needing custom code for connecting form data. Select builders with an integration marketplace to extend available connections.

Integrations are what allow the form data to flow seamlessly to wherever it needs to go - databases, email lists, payment systems, document storage, analytics platforms, etc. Look for native integrations to popular platforms like MySQL, Salesforce, MailChimp, Stripe, PayPal, and more. Strong integration options let you get form data where it needs to go without tedious manual transfers or custom coding. An integration marketplace or API connectivity allows adding even more integrations as needed. Prioritize form builders with robust integration capabilities to save work.

Conditional Logic

Conditional logic creates smart branching forms that adapt based on user responses. This allows personalized quiz and survey experiences. For example, a survey could skip irrelevant questions based on a user's previous answers, improving the flow. Look for easy ways to set up conditional logic without coding. Prioritize builders that support multiple conditional logic options per form. Conditional logic is essential for market research surveys and assessments.

One of the most powerful form features is conditional logic, which allows the form to branch based on the user's responses. This creates a dynamic, personalized experience ideal for quizzes, surveys, assessments, and research. Conditional logic avoids linear forms that ask irrelevant questions. Make sure the form builder has an easy visual interface for setting up conditional logic without coding. You want robust options for "if/then" logic, multiple conditions per form, etc. Conditional logic takes forms to the next level for gathering better quality data.

Customizable Themes

Themes allow forms to match website branding and styles. Prioritize builders with a wide selection of customizable themes. Drag-and-drop theme editing speeds design without custom CSS. Match forms to site look and feel with on-brand themes. Custom themes create cohesive experiences for users.

Make sure the form builder offers themes or templates that allow styling the form to match your brand. Drag-and-drop theme customization allows tweaking colors, fonts, etc. without coding. Quality themes prevent forms that look generic. Matching your website's look and feel avoids a disjointed experience when users go from your site to a form. Prioritize form builders with a wide variety of professional themes you can customize to your brand style.

Analytics

Form analytics provide insights into user responses and behavior. Dashboards to visualize results and track form performance over time. Analytics help identify issues like form abandonment. Data can be exported to external platforms for further analysis. Prioritize robust analytics beyond just total submissions.

Analytics complete the package by providing visibility into form performance. Dashboards should allow viewing response summaries, abandonment rates, completion metrics, and trends over time. Robust analytics help optimize forms for better conversions. Make sure analytics include exports to enable further analysis in external tools. Prioritize form builders that go beyond basic submission counts with rich analytics and custom reporting on response rates, completion times, question responses, and more.

Top Online Form Builders for Developers

Based on the key criteria, here are top form builders developers should consider:

  • Typeform - Extremely user-friendly with engaging templates.
  • JotForm - Feature-packed with HIPAA compliance.
  • Wufoo - Affordable and intuitive option.
  • Google Forms - Free and seamlessly integrated with Google Workspace.
  • Formstack - Robust features with Salesforce integration.
  • Devtalk - Specifically designed for developer tools and integrations.

Typeform

One of the most user-friendly and visually engaging form builders. Focus on conversational forms with fun templates. Arrange fields via drag-and-drop on both desktop and mobile. Basic conditional logic available in the free plan. Limited native integrations but Zapier expands options. Analytics provide response summaries and completion rates.

Typeform stands out for its intuitive interface and visually engaging form templates that feel more conversational. The drag-and-drop editor is fantastic for quickly constructing forms on both desktop and mobile. It has basic conditional logic features even on the free plan. Native integrations are limited but you can connect additional services through Zapier. The analytics and summaries provide the key metrics around responses and completion rate. Overall Typeform is ideal if you want great usability and eye-catching forms.

JotForm

Very powerful form builder with tons of customization options. HIPAA compliance makes it suitable for medical forms. Robust form analytics and integrations like PayPal. Higher pricing tiers unlock more features and options. Can build multi-page forms with progress bars. Access to form templates and themes.

JotForm is a robust form builder with an abundance of features for developers. It meets HIPAA compliance standards making it suitable for medical uses. You get access to hundreds of form templates and themes for custom styling. JotForm has top-notch native integrations with PayPal, Stripe, Salesforce, MailChimp, and more. Form analytics are very detailed for optimizing forms. Higher pricing tiers unlock additional capabilities like multi-page forms, clones, and conditional logic. JotForm is great for developers who want maximum functionality.

Wufoo

Intuitive drag-and-drop editor at an affordable price. Good selection of themes and customization options. Integrations with services like MailChimp, Salesforce, Zapier. Can embed forms on your website with snippets. Decent analytics with charts and filtering. Mobile-friendly forms.

Wufoo hits a sweet spot between ease of use and features. Its drag-and-drop editor is intuitive and it has mobile responsiveness. You get themes and customization to brand forms. Wufoo connects to many top services like MailChimp, Salesforce, Slack, and more via integrations and Zapier. Forms can be embedded easily through code snippets. The analytics offer good insights with charts and filtering options. Wufoo is a great blend of usability, features, and affordability.

Google Forms

Free and built into Google Workspace accounts. Tight integration with other Google services. Easy to create quizzes, surveys, registrations, etc. Limited customization options compared to paid builders. Can view summary charts from responses. Great for simple forms with no coding.

The appeal of Google Forms is the free cost and tight integration if you already use Google Workspace tools like Drive, Docs, Sheets, etc. It makes creating quizzes, surveys, and registrations easy without any coding. But customization and advanced features are limited compared to paid platforms. You can view charts summarizing responses and some basic metrics. Google Forms is great for simple forms if you want free and fast within the Google ecosystem.

Formstack

Powerful form builder with tons of field options. Native Salesforce integration along with Zapier. Customizable themes and multi-page form support. Higher pricing tier needed for more robust features. Form abandonment reports in analytics. 24/7 customer support.

Formstack is feature-rich with tons of form field choices and robust functionality. It has native Salesforce integration enabling easy connection to databases and CRM data. The Premium plan unlocks features like multi-page forms, advanced logic, and APIs. You can customize themes or use pre-made templates. Analytics include helpful form abandonment reports. Formstack has 24/7 customer support options for issues. The platform scales from simple to advanced forms as your needs grow.

Devtalk

Form building tailored specifically for developers. Library of field types for software data collection. Built-in integrations for developer tools and APIs. Embeddable code snippet for forms. Customizable themes to match developer brand styles. Usage analytics to optimize form conversion.

Devtalk focuses specifically on form building for developer tools and APIs. It has pre-made field types for collecting data like software requirements, feature requests, bug reports, API integrations, etc. This saves developers time. It has native integrations optimized for common developer platforms and tools. Embed code snippets allow easy form integration into documentation sites. Usage analytics help track form conversions and optimization. The builder allows customizing themes to match your developer brand. Devtalk streamlines form building for developer-specific use cases.

Choosing the Best Form Builder for Your Needs

With an abundance of form builder options, focus on choosing the right platform for your specific needs:

  • Evaluate available integrations and data connections needed. Prioritize builders with the right native integrations or expansion options like Zapier.

  • Assess the level of conditional logic and customization required. More complex forms may require higher-tier plans with advanced features. Simple forms can use free or basic plans.

  • Consider form analytics needs for tracking and optimizing forms. Make sure the platform provides the right metrics and dashboards.

  • Compare pricing tiers to find plan with ideal features. Check if higher tiers are needed for key functionality.

  • Test builders with free trials to evaluate editors and themes. Experience the interfaces and design process before deciding.

  • Prioritize an intuitive interface for rapid form building. Drag-and-drop and minimal coding improves creation speed.

  • Think through future form needs to select scalable platform. Will you need multi-page forms, APIs, etc. later on?

  • Strike balance between ease-of-use and advanced functionality. Assess what is essential now vs. nice-to-have.

  • Select form builder aligned with primary use cases and audience. Certain builders cater to developers, marketers, etc.

  • Consider startups like Devtalk that tailor specifically to developers. Their focus can provide optimized experiences.

Take time to carefully evaluate your needs and use cases before selecting a form builder. Test out promising options to get hands-on with the interfaces. Weigh the pros and cons of simplicity vs features. Choosing the ideal form builder can yield huge time savings for developers.

Go Forth and Build Smarter Forms

Online form builders empower developers to create forms quickly without coding. Leverage conditional logic to make smart surveys that adapt to responses. Focus on find a builder with the right mix of ease-of-use and functionality. Integrations eliminate manual data transfer between forms and other apps. Continually optimize forms using analytics data on responses and completion rates. Well-designed forms provide great user experiences and capture quality data. The right form builder saves significant development time for any project.

Form builders open up new possibilities for developers to efficiently create dynamic forms without complex coding. Conditional logic unlocks smart surveys and quizzes that respond to user input. Take time to find the form builder that balances simplicity with the features you need—both now and in the future. Robust integrations and analytics enable streamlined data flows and continuous form optimization. Online form builders enable developers to build not just faster, but also smarter. The result is great UX and quality data. With the multitude of excellent form building options available today, developers can kickstart virtually any project.